Café Culture And Sweet Dishes In Tripoli
Tripoli comes as a good entertainment package when it is about food and activities like shopping.  Libya is a strict Arabic country and drinking in public or otherwise is banned here. Nightlife Pub, bar and nightclub culture is not very popular in The North African country of Libya. There are bars in few hotels, but they aren’t very good either. Night out in Tripoli means dining, entertainment though theatres, cinemas’ and a café culture. Some of the good theatres of Tripoli are the al-Rabitah al Thakafiyyah and the Dar al Fann. City complex and Las Salinas to the south  of the city and other places like al-Opera, Rivoli, Colorado etc are some of the cinemas you could go to catch a movie. The White Bride Of The Mediterranean
Tripoli or Tarabulus as the city is known in Arabic was once a part of Tripolitania – the province of three cities –Tripoli, Sabratha and Leptis Magna. After the Arab conquest in the 7th century, the city came to be known with what it is called today- Tripoli. The ‘White Bride of the Mediterranean’ as the nick named of the city goes is just apt. It is substantiated by the Arab, Ottoman and the Italian influence on the city’s architecture. Location The capital city of Libya, Tripoli is in North Africa and stretches to about 1820 kilometers along the Mediterranean coastline. The country, Libya shares its eastern border with Egypt. Happening Festivals And Special Events
The city’s calendar is never free of festivals due to its rich cultural identity. Tango Festival The festival came into existence from the year 1999 and is organized in the months of February and March. More than 100 free shows are arranged during the festival. The festival continues for six days and is gaining more popularity year after year. Buenos Aires International Festival of Independent Cinema The festival provides a stage to the directors from all over the world to showcase their best works. The festival arranged by Secretaria de Cultura de Buenos Aires is organized in the various venues of the city. The Lion City- Singapore
The name of the city Singapore is derived from the original Malaya name of the city which was Singapura which means the lion city. The study reveals that the name lion city was given but no lions, not even the Asian lions ever existed in Singapore. Singapore has tigers that too Malay tigers, after whom the name was been given. Sir Stanford Raffles was the founder of the country. Singapore is the smallest country in Southeast Asia. Singapore country is made up of nearly 63 islands reclaimed together. Till the date there are many reclamation projections going on Singapore and as a result the area of 582 sq.km has increased to 704 sq.km also it is expected to grow more 100 sq.km by 2030. Festive Eve In Phnom Penh
The festivals and the events that take place in the city of Phnom Penh are wonderful get-together of the oldest rituals of the city and the latest developed culture of the place. This exotic mixture of the new and the old makes the festivals and the events very much exciting. They play a very important role in attracting a huge number of tourists visiting such a great city from every corner of the world. So lets you a quick look at the city’s top festivals and events. Bonn Chroat Preah Nongkoal is a royal rice ploughing festival in Phnom Penh in the month of May every year. It marks the beginning of the ploughing season.
